    2.A gift is a present transfer of property by one person to another without any consideration or compensation.
    贈與是一方不考慮任何對價或補償而現(xiàn)實的轉(zhuǎn)移財產(chǎn)所有權(quán)予另一方.
    3.A gift to “my child” that does not set out the children’s name is a class gift.
    不具體寫明子女姓名,只寫出贈與”我的子女”之贈與是概括贈與.
    4.Capacity of donor is one of the essential requisites of “gift”.
    贈與人的行為能力是”贈與”的一個重要前提.
    5.In the case of a gift the thing itself passes to the donee.
    就贈與而言,贈物本身要交付給受贈人.
    6.Only a complete gift is taxable under the gift tax.
    根據(jù)贈與稅規(guī)定,只有完全贈與才應(yīng)納稅.
    7.payment of gift tax is the obligation of the donor, not the recipient.
    交納贈與稅的義務(wù)在贈與人而非受贈人.
    8.The gift is subject to the federal unified transfer tax.
    該贈與應(yīng)交納聯(lián)邦統(tǒng)一轉(zhuǎn)讓稅.
